Emerging demands for renewable energy have propelled enzyme preparations to the forefront of sustainable biofuel production. As industries confront tightening environmental regulations and heightened consumer expectations, enzyme technologies offer unparalleled improvements in conversion efficiencies and process economics. Transitioning from traditional chemical catalysts to engineered biocatalysts represents a paradigm shift, enabling lower energy inputs, reduced greenhouse gas emissions, and expanded feedstock flexibility.

Furthermore, the maturation of biotechnological tools has accelerated the development of specialized formulations, allowing producers to tailor enzyme blends to specific substrates such as lignocellulosic biomass and waste oils. In turn, this adaptability lowers operational costs and diminishes reliance on finite fossil resources. In addition, cross-industry collaborations among academic institutions, contract manufacturers, and biofuel producers have fostered an ecosystem of innovation that continually refines enzyme performance under industrial conditions.

Traditional reliance on high-temperature or chemical-intensive processes has hindered scalability and sustainable credentials. Conversely, biocatalytic routes harness molecular specificity to optimize reaction pathways while minimizing byproducts. This compelling value proposition has captured the attention of stakeholders across the value chain, from feedstock suppliers to end-user assemblers. As a result, decision-makers are prioritizing enzyme-based strategies within broader decarbonization roadmaps, highlighting the sector’s strategic importance.

Revealing Critical Market Segmentation Dynamics That Shape Enzyme Preparations Adoption Across Diverse Biofuel Applications and End User Profiles

A nuanced understanding of application-based segmentation reveals distinct pathways through which enzyme preparations catalyze biofuel production. Within the biodiesel arena, formulations tailored for animal fat transesterification differ in their operational parameters compared to those optimized for vegetable oil substrates, thereby necessitating targeted enzyme blends that account for feedstock composition. Meanwhile, enzymatic processes used in bioethanol production must adapt to the divergent characteristics of first generation feedstocks such as sugar and starch crops versus second generation lignocellulosic biomass, where robust cellulolytic and hemicellulolytic activities are paramount. In parallel, the biogas sector draws upon specialized enzyme cocktails designed to enhance anaerobic digestion of agricultural residues, industrial effluents, and municipal organic waste, underscoring the importance of precision in catalytic design.

Equally critical is the classification by enzyme type, as the market encompasses a broad spectrum of catalysts from cellulase variants like beta glucosidase, endoglucanase, and exoglucanase, to hemicellulase, laccase, and xylanase. Each category exhibits unique kinetics and substrate affinities, informing deployment strategies and process optimization protocols. Furthermore, the choice between liquid and powder formulations introduces additional layers of operational flexibility; while liquid enzymes offer immediate activity and ease of dosing, powder preparations can deliver enhanced stability and cost efficiencies in storage and transport. Ultimately, segmentation by end user underscores the divergent requirements of biofuel producers focused on large-scale throughput, contract manufacturing organizations prioritizing customizable solutions, and research and academic institutions driving foundational innovation. Through this integrated lens, stakeholders can align enzyme selection and deployment strategies with specific application demands, unlocking the full potential of catalyst-driven bioenergy.

Unveiling Regional Variations in Enzyme Preparation Demand Driven by Policy, Infrastructure, and Investment Trends Across Global Energy Markets

Regional dynamics play a pivotal role in shaping the demand trajectory for enzyme preparations across the Americas, Europe Middle East & Africa, and Asia-Pacific markets. In North America and Latin America, supportive policy frameworks and incentives for renewable fuels have accelerated adoption of enzyme-based processes, particularly in biodiesel and bioethanol sectors where feedstock availability aligns with established agricultural supply chains. Meanwhile, ample infrastructure for ethanol distribution and blending mandates reinforces the integration of advanced catalysts, prompting domestic producers to invest in tailored formulation capabilities that cater to regional feedstock profiles.

Across Europe, Middle East & Africa, regulatory rigor around carbon emissions and circular economy objectives fosters a vibrant environment for enzyme innovation. The European Union’s emphasis on advanced biofuels coupled with stringent waste management policies has elevated demand for enzymatic treatments in both second generation bioethanol initiatives and industrial-scale biogas projects. Similarly, emerging markets in the Middle East are beginning to leverage enzyme technologies for waste-to-energy applications, driven by a dual imperative to reduce landfill burdens and diversify energy portfolios.

In the Asia-Pacific region, rapid industrialization and growing energy needs have sparked significant investment in bioenergy infrastructure, with enzyme preparations playing a central role in improving conversion yields. Countries with large agricultural sectors are exploring enzymatic routes to valorize crop residues and municipal waste streams, while nations with strong pharmaceutical and biotech sectors are contributing to a pipeline of specialized enzyme formulations. In addition, collaborative efforts between government agencies and research institutions are accelerating technology transfer, ensuring that enzyme preparation advancements keep pace with the region’s ambitious renewable energy targets.

Highlighting Strategic Moves and Competitive Positioning of Leading Enzyme Manufacturers Shaping the Future of Bio-Based Energy Solutions

Leading enzyme manufacturers are executing strategic initiatives that reinforce their competitive positioning in the rapidly evolving bioenergy landscape. Recent alliances between enzyme producers and biofuel refiners underscore a trend toward co-development models, where bespoke enzyme blends are tailored to integrate seamlessly with proprietary process architectures. At the same time, concurrent capacity expansion projects signal a commitment to localized production, reducing lead times and mitigating the impact of trade-related uncertainties.

Product innovation remains at the forefront of corporate agendas, with several market participants unveiling new high-performance cellulase variants exhibiting enhanced thermostability and resistance to inhibitory compounds present in lignocellulosic feedstocks. Other entities are expanding their portfolios to include auxiliary enzymes such as laccase and xylanase, enabling comprehensive biomass deconstruction workflows that drive higher yield and throughput. Moreover, the emergence of proprietary immobilization technologies is providing a competitive edge by facilitating enzyme reuse and streamlining downstream separation operations.

Beyond technological enhancements, sustainability credentials are increasingly influencing investor sentiment, prompting firms to publish detailed environmental impact assessments and engage in circular economy pilots. Finally, a wave of mergers and acquisitions is consolidating expertise across geography and function, as companies seek to bolster their innovation pipelines and secure strategic footholds in key growth regions. Collectively, these strategic moves are redefining the competitive contours of the enzyme preparations market, ensuring that leading players remain agile and responsive to the dynamic demands of the bio-based energy sector.
